I got an E-Began off Amazon. Lots of different colors- I got the clear case with just a little blue and purple to it that is pretty but not over the top loud.
I did have to remove the built in screen protector as it totally interfered with the proximity sensor. The case itself I like quite well. It has a good grip to it without feeling too sticky or anything. I don't like to change cases around too much so as long as it holds up-will be the one I keep on it. But I am glad to see I have numerous options if I ever want to try a second case or so.
